Walsden win overhauls rivals

WALSDEN A kept up their challenge for runner's-up spot in A Division of the Todmorden Bowling League thanks to a victory which saw them leap-frog New Street B into third place.
New Street A’s victory over Walsden B took them over the 100 point mark for the season.

Catholic Club A had a busy time in B Division as they played at Walsden C in a fixture rained-off the previous week as well as their scheduled match against Ha
re and Hounds B.

But defeat at Walsden meant that they did not take full advantage of their game in hand against leaders Rose and Crown A.

New Street A hit three figures in the Veterans A Division standings too.

In Veterans two Lanctan hold a healthy lead but just one point separates Kirkholt A and New Street B in second place.
